Meet the team

Northallerton GP Training Programme is part of the HEE Yorkshire Deanery. The local team are:

 

 

Dr Peter Green

Dr Peter Green, Programme Director

Peter has been a Training Programmme Director for manyyears.  He is a GP at Great Ayton.  Peter is also an advanced consultation skills and CME tutor.

 

 

 

 

Dr David Cole, Programme Director

David completed his training on the Northallerton GP Training Programme before working initially at Mayford House in Northallerrton and is now a partner at Stokesley Surgery.

 

 

 

Mrs Wendy Buch, Programme Administrator

Wendy has worked within Postgraduate Services for more than seventeen years and during this time has supported many GP trainees throughout their training and to achieve their career goals.

Dr Higson

Dr Roger Higson, Retired Programme Director

Retired from GP education, Roger Higson is a very experienced educator involved in selection for GP education and the assessment of doctors in difficulty.  Roger has special interests in using the creative arts as a resource in teaching.  He is co-author of the book "The Arts in Medical Education - A Practical Guide".
